Our Mission
At The Landry Cook Manor, our mission is to provide a safe, supportive, and nurturing residential environment for girls ages 10–18. We are committed not just to providing shelter, but to building a home, a future, and a sense of family — one girl at a time. Through compassion and purpose-driven care, we believe each day holds the promise of restoration, learning, and transformation — supported by therapeutic services, academic guidance, life skills development, and meaningful recreational experiences.
QUICK FACTS
-
Ages Served
Girls ages 10–18 from diverse backgrounds..
-
Professional Care
Licensed social workers, Registered nurse and trauma-informed staff.
-
Life Skills Development
Equipping girls with real-world skills for lifelong independence.
-
Academic Support
Building confidence and growth through targeted academic guidance.
-
Recreation & Enrichment
Creating joy, connection, and confidence through daily activities.
-
Trauma-Informed Care
Helping girls heal through consistent emotional support and trauma-informed care.
